This is not the doctor's forum, and I am by no means a professional, but here is what I think. IgM tests are meaningless - I'm surprised you doctor even ordered this test. The only reliable, accurate herpes tests are type-specific IgG. From your results, it looks like you had the HerpeSelect test and are negative for both types 1 and 2. HerpeSelect tests can take up to four months to become positive. However, if you had no previous symptoms and your tests are negative, you probably don't have genital herpes. However, get re-tested in a few months to be positive.
